    2、解决内存吃紧问题 

    (1)问题描述 

            Android Studio 安装目录的-xmx 参数是 Java 虚拟机启动时的参数,用于限制最大堆内存。Android Studio 启动时设置了这个参数,并且默认值很小。 一旦你的工程变大,IDE 运行时间稍长,内存就开始吃紧,频繁触发 GC,自然会卡。

    (2)方法步骤 

            每次升级/安装 Android Studio 之后都修改android-studio/bin/studio64.exe.vmoptions studio64.vmoptions 两个文件的以下属性: 

    -Xms2048m 
    -Xmx2048m 
    -XX:MaxPermSize=2048m 
    -XX:ReservedCodeCacheSize=2048m

    -XX:+IgnoreUnrecognizedVMOptions
    -XX:+UseG1GC
    -XX:SoftRefLRUPolicyMSPerMB=50
    -XX:CICompilerCount=2
    -XX:+HeapDumpOnOutOfMemoryError
    -XX:-OmitStackTraceInFastThrow
    -ea
    -Dsun.io.useCanonCaches=false
    -Djdk.http.auth.tunneling.disabledSchemes=""
    -Djdk.attach.allowAttachSelf=true
    -Djdk.module.illegalAccess.silent=true
    -Djna.nosys=true
    -Djna.boot.library.path=
    -Didea.vendor.name=Google
    -Dkotlinx.coroutines.debug=off

    3、解决构建速度慢问题 

    (1)问题描述 

            随着项目的增大,依赖库的增多,构建速度越来越慢,现在最慢要6分钟才能build一个release的安装包

    (2)方法 

            开启gradle单独的守护进程,增大gradle运行的java虚拟机的大小,让gradle在编译的时候使用独立进程,让gradle可以平行的运行。


    ①在下面的目录下面创建gradle.properties文件:C:\Users\.gradle (Windows)

    ②在文件中增加:org.gradle.daemon=true

    ③优化以上用户目录下的gradle.properties文件,配置如下:

    # Project-wide Gradle settings.
     
    # IDE (e.g. Android Studio) users:
    # Settings specified in this file will override any Gradle settings
    # configured through the IDE.
     
    # For more details on how to configure your build environment visit
    # http://www.gradle.org/docs/current/userguide/build_environment.html
     
    # The Gradle daemon aims to improve the startup and execution time of Gradle.
    # When set to true the Gradle daemon is to run the build.
    # TODO: disable daemon on CI, since builds should be clean and reliable on servers
    org.gradle.daemon=true
     
    # Specifies the JVM arguments used for the daemon process.
    # The setting is particularly useful for tweaking memory settings.
    # Default value: -Xmx10248m -XX:MaxPermSize=256m
    org.gradle.jvmargs=-Xmx2048m -XX:MaxPermSize=512m -XX:+HeapDumpOnOutOfMemoryError -Dfile.encoding=UTF-8
     
    # When configured, Gradle will run in incubating parallel mode.
    # This option should only be used with decoupled projects. More details, visit
    # http://www.gradle.org/docs/current/userguide/multi_project_builds.html#sec:decoupled_projects
    org.gradle.parallel=true
     
    # Enables new incubating mode that makes Gradle selective when configuring projects. 
    # Only relevant projects are configured which results in faster builds for large multi-projects.
    # http://www.gradle.org/docs/current/userguide/multi_project_builds.html#sec:configuration_on_demand
    org.gradle.configureondemand=true
